Unprofessional company extended warranty fraudsters
I was foolish enough to purchase the extended warranty plans for the firearms I purchased at gander mountain. I was rudefully informed by a salesmen and then by a store manager that gander mountain warranty plans are no longer honored at any of their stores that are closing and that they are protected under bankruptcy proceeding.
No refund or compensation would be offered to their customers. I later am informed by a firearms manufacturer that no extended warranty is ever needed as all manufacturers will repair or replace all firearms from original owners that are defective and have not been modified.. Free of charge.
Shipping paid for included. This Gander Mountain extended warranty plan was not needed and is clearly designed to defraud and mislead the customers.

Disallowed Rewards Certificate
On the 9th of May, I went to my local Gander Mountain store to use a gift card and $30 of Rewards Certificates.. I purchased $150 of merchandise, used the gift card and tried to redeem the Rewards Certificates.
The sales person said that they would not honor the Rewards Certificates. I asked why ? They said that the corporate office told them in that morning that the certificates were invalid... He gave me a card that had the Gander Mountain website and suggested I contact customer service.......website did not function .
I guess I am out $30...
It is unfortunate that the Gander Mountain company treats its customers in this way. It may be a hint to why they are going out of business.

They are not honoring gift card
they announced that they were going to close select stores. I visited my local store about one month ago and was told that store would NOT be closing and that I would be able to continue to use my gift card.
Well, this past Memorial Day weekend I visited the store to shop and when I got there I noticed these big signs announcing the closing of the store and when I went to checkout the cashier informed me that they no longer accept the gift cards they sold. I spoke to the store manager and he told me the same thing.
They are closing down Gander Mountain and reopening as Gander Outdoors. WHAT A RIP-OFF!!!!!

Try rewards certificates again
I went to gander mountain to use my reward certificates in early May and a sign posted there indicated my rewards certificates would not be honored. So I left somewhat annoyed.
I checked the gander mountain website today, May 27th, to see what recourse I had. The website indicated they would honor the rewards certificates. I called my local store and they confirmed they would honor the rewards certificates. I went to the store and indeed the rewards certificates were honored.
I was pleased to be able to use my more than $100 in rewards certificates. Using the rewards certificates, and some cash, I purchased men's shoes, shorts, and a shirt.
Each item was on sale for 25% off. So my rewards certificates went further than I thought they would go.

Gander Mtn. Rewards Certificate Issue
I have a couple of $10 rewards certificates that expire in late July and August 2017. I'm staying in Ontario Canada for the summer at a lake and figured I would order some Gander Mtn merchandise online to use up my $20 worth of EARNED reward credit, but there is apparently no functioning online catalog at this time.
The new company "Gander Outdoors" states that you can still use the rewards certificates IN STORE, but this does not help me at all since I'm hundreds of miles from the nearest one, and will not get close to a store location until after the certificates expire. I don't feel this is fair to a customer who has earned these certificates through Gander Moutain Credit Card use.
Why should I be penalized just because they temporarily shut down their online catalog? That's their issue, not the customer's.
